TikTok superstar and musical theatre actor **Dylan Mulvaney** plays with all the labels that land at her door – navigating dating, delusion, and her relationship with God in this new one-woman musical.

Known for joyous TikTok series *Days of Girlhood*, which channels her transition, **Dylan** is back at her day job – where it all began – musical theatre. **FAGHAG** , which is at **Edinburgh Festival Fringe** in August, is an hour of original musical numbers which chart **Dylan’s** life where she is now, being friends with Gaga and Rachel Bloom, embracing her authenticity and those friends who have stuck like glue through everything; all while looking inward – celebrating her girlhood and exploring her relationship with God having grown up queer in the Catholic church.

An ex-twink with musical theatre credits including Broadway’s cast for *Book of Mormon*, **Dylan** is a bonafide stage star ready to take the Edinburgh Festival Fringe with composers from across Broadway providing original songs and direction from **Tim Robinson** (*Two Strangers, Merrily We Roll Along*). **Dylan’s** most recent stage outing was *365: Live!*; to celebrate her first year of transition, **Dylan** produced a show at the **Rainbow Room** supporting the **Trevor Project** and raised nearly $200,000, showcasing her musical talent in a joyous return to the live performance.

**Dylan Mulvaney** commented: *“*I am over the moon excited to return back to my theatre roots! *FAGHAG* is a campy, queer love letter to my younger self, and my way of taking my story off of social media and onto the stage. I have a deep respect for the solo performance art form, and I can’t think of a more iconic place to premiere it than Edinburgh Fringe.”

**FAGHAG**, which is produced and supported by **Seaview, Wessex Grove** and **AEG presents, is at Edinburgh Fringe Festival** from **1 August – 25 August. Tickets [HERE](https://assemblyfestival.com/whats-on/650-dylan-mulvaney-fghag?ref=scenemag.co.uk)**
